Find the density of a sample that has a volume of 36.5L and a mass of 10.0kg

1 Answer

4 votes
  • Answer:

≈ 0,27 g/cm³

  • Step-by-step explanation:

36.5 l = 36.5 dm³ = 36500 cm³

10 kg = 10000 g

d = m/V

= 10000g/36500cm³

≈ 0,27 g/cm³
